Fixed speed enforcement cameras of any type (Gatso, Peek, Truvelo, Monitron or SPECS), Average Speed Cameras should be mapped as per the linked guidance. If the camera is reversible you will need to map two cameras, one facing in each direction. While a Red Light Camera will always give an alert in the client as a driver approaches, a Speed Camera will always show a pop-up alert, but will only generate an audible alert if the driver is exceeding the set speed limit as the vehicle crosses an invisible threshold one-half (1/2) mile from the camera's placement. Monitron speed cameras (sometimes referred to as SpeedCurb) are a new generation of digital cameras which can be configured as a speed and / or a red light camera.
